2014-01-23 71 views
0

如果我要问这个问题已经问了,请直接指向我的链接,因为我没有找到它。对于Google Play中的测试版测试,您是否必须首先在新版APK取代之前先发布测试版APK?您是否也可以上传相同的版本代码,或者您是否必须在Beta版中上传每个APK的情况下创建新的版本代码?Android应用程序Beta上传到谷歌播放

我问的原因是我正准备测试新版本的应用程序。我在我的测试手机上升级了应用程序,并且崩溃了。我发现有一行代码我忘了带出来进行测试,导致升级失败。这很有趣,因为测试代码正在间接测试升级代码。无论如何,所以我不想上传一个全新的代码版本,只是覆盖预先存在的APK上传。我希望这是可能的,因为它只处于Beta状态。另外,我想这意味着必须再等24小时才能使其新的Beta APK上传生效。这是我希望绕过的另一件事是在Beta中上传相同的版本将消除现有的Beta版本代码,以便更改立即可升级。我假设的一厢情愿。

谢谢您提前。

+2

这个问题似乎是题外话,因为它是关于一个应用程序商店更新应用程序,而不是直接编程有关。 – Abizern

+1

这是直接从那里帮助页面的问题。 “软件开发所特有的实际的,可回答的问题”。软件开发包括部署。这会使这个问题变得合法。正如帮助部分所指出的那样,不是试图一直抛出“编程”评论,就像您在我的其他帖子中所做的那样,尝试了解该站点的实际用途。 –

+1

此外,Abizern,你回答了有关Git相关问题的stackoverflow的someones问题。这不是直接编程,而是与软件开发有关。因此,你所有的帖子,关于不直接编程相关,已被抹黑。 –

回答

1

不,您不必取消发布您的应用程序以上传新的测试版本。但是,您必须增加版本代码才能发布新的Beta版本。版本代码必须增加,因此安装应用程序的设备可以通过将安装的版本代码与Google Play版本代码进行比较来跟踪是否有更新。

每当您发布新版本或更新您的应用程序信息时,这些更改可能需要几个小时才能传播。根据我的经验,只有大约5个小时才会有人收到更新通知。如果你真的为新版本所需时间困扰,你可以使用不同的应用程序分发服务,例如HockeyApp,TestFlight等...

+0

感谢您的信息。肯定花了超过5个小时才能在我的测试手机上收到更新。我昨天下午和今天早上6点半左右上传了,我查了一下,但仍然没有升级版本。不过,当我在下午1点左右再次查看时,我做到了。了解时间表和工作流程,而不是被它困扰。如果我必须等到明天早上,我必须等到明天早上或者更新发现方法时才能看到。 –

1

当你的应用程序准备好生产时,不必取消发布,只需“促进生产”,您不必更改versionCode

如果您的测试版应用程序有错误,进行了更改并且必须上传另一个.apk文件,并且是,则必须更改为较新的versionCode

如果您的应用已发布,则无法覆盖预先存在的APK。

enter image description here

+0

Beta错误是我所指的。我希望我可以用新的上传覆盖当前的Beta版APK,它就像是瞬间升级。对我而言,这是一厢情愿的想法,但至少在询问有没有人知道这种方式是没有坏处的。感谢您的信息。 –

+1

对不起,如果你的应用发布了,你不能覆盖文件,你必须上传另一个,带有一个新的codeVersion,然后重新发布。 =(并等待一段时间,直到你可以看到你的apk的新版本。 – Jorgesys

+1

不用担心,我只是感谢你响应。我有点想通这是值得怀疑的与应用程序和数据在任何时候都流动量。 –

相关问题